Two Azerbaijani badminton players ranked in the world's top 100 for the first time

Two Azerbaijani athletes have for the first time in history entered the top 100 strongest badminton players in the world.

The press service of the Azerbaijan Badminton Federation told "Report" about this.

The list was published by the Badminton World Federation (BWF).

Young athlete Ulvi Huseynov, who is remembered for his successful performances at international tournaments, rose to 63rd place in the ranking. He recently scored 4050 rating points by being among the prize-winners at international tournaments held in the Islamic Republic of Iran and Turkey.

Our other young representative, Hajar Nuriyeva, advanced 21 places in the ranking to 47th place by being among the prize-winners at international tournaments held in Tajikistan, Spain, Turkey, Zambia and Botswana in 2023 and 2024. Most recently, in the international tournament held in 2025 in the Islamic Republic of Iran, she won a gold medal in the doubles category with Leyla Jamalzade, increasing her rating points to 5800.

It should be noted that Ulvi Huseynov, since 2023, has been studying at the Malaysian Badminton Academy based on the memorandum of cooperation signed between the Azerbaijan Badminton Federation and the Malaysian Badminton Federation, and regularly participates in training camps with members of the Malaysian national teams of various age groups, increasing his level of professionalism.

It should be noted that the inclusion of local athletes in the world's "Top-100" badminton players list is one of the main goals of the Azerbaijan Badminton Federation's strategy for 2025-2028.
